`
lintide
  • 浏览: 33460 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
最近访客 更多访客>>
社区版块
存档分类
最新评论

scrubyt出现RubyInline (= 3.6.3)错误

    博客分类:
  • ruby
阅读更多
在irb中输入
require 'scrubyt'

出现以下错误信息:
Gem::Exception: can't activate RubyInline (= 3.6.3), already activated RubyInline-3.6.6]
        from /usr/lib/ruby/1.8/rubygems.rb:254:in `activate'
        from /usr/lib/ruby/1.8/rubygems.rb:272:in `activate'
        from /usr/lib/ruby/1.8/rubygems.rb:271:in `each'
        from /usr/lib/ruby/1.8/rubygems.rb:271:in `activate'
        from /usr/lib/ruby/1.8/rubygems/custom_require.rb:31:in `require'
        from (irb):3
irb(main):004:0> exit



解决方法:
输入以下命令:
gem uninstall RubyInline

出现:
Select gem to uninstall:
 1. RubyInline-3.6.3
 2. RubyInline-3.6.6
 3. All versions

选择2,回车,这样就删除了3.6.6版本了

不知为什么?当使用
gem install scrubyt
安装scrubyt时,总是会把RubyInline的两个版本都安装下去
分享到:
评论
1 楼 pickerel 2008-01-25  
我也碰到这问题了,谢谢分享你的经验。

相关推荐

Global site tag (gtag.js) - Google Analytics